The Belly Fat Cure Diet

By suga­rfre­eDiv­a Added at June 23, 2010 Views 1,903 Reviews 16 4.1295 stars

Jorge Cruise's book on losing stubborn belly fat. A good book to decipher the ins and outs of carb counting — good carbs vs. bad (belly good vs. belly bad) and healthy eatting in general. Also highlights the myriad of artificial sweetners out there and how they affect our bodies.
